What is Acumentis Group Debt-to-Equity?

Acumentis Group ASX:ACU +3.66% Debt-to-Equity is 0.08 as of Dec. 2025, which is 47% below its 10-year median of 0.15. The stock has 3 warning signs investors should review. Among 1,541 Real Estate companies, Acumentis Group ranks better than 88.25% on this metric.

Acumentis Group's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2025 was A$0.91 Mil. Acumentis Group's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2025 was A$1.09 Mil. Acumentis Group's Total Stockholders Equity for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2025 was A$26.28 Mil. Acumentis Group's debt to equity for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2025 was 0.08.

A high debt to equity ratio generally means that a company has been aggressive in financing its growth with debt. This can result in volatile earnings as a result of the additional interest expense.

Acumentis Group  (ASX:ACU) Debt-to-Equity Explanation

In the calculation of Debt to Equity, we use the total of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ation and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ation divided by Total Stockholders Equity. In some calculations, Total Liabilities is used to for calculation.


Be Aware

Because a company can increase its ROE % by having more financial leverage, it is important to watch the leverage ratio when investing in high ROE % companies.

Acumentis Group Business Description

Address 35 Boundary Street, Level 4, South Brisbane, QLD, AUS, 4001
Acumentis Group Ltd is engaged in commercial and residential property valuation. It provides valuation and other services such as property advisory services, commercial property valuation, government property services, agribusiness and rural property valuation, and others. It also provides services to assist in family law settlements, deceased estates, probate, self-managed super funds, business valuations, and others.
